5 Fascinating tactics to generate B2C Leads

In this 21st century, most of the companies are indulged in the cutthroat competition to take the reins of the market. Lead generation firms...

Are you a Social Media Addict?

Merriam-Webster: Definition of addict1: to devote or surrender (oneself) to something habitually or obsessively was addicted to gambling 2: to cause addiction to a...